This item was featured on CodeCanyon
jdgower
- Item was Featured
- Sold between 5 000 and 10 000 dollars
- Has been a member for 2-3 years
- Exclusive Author
- Bought between 10 and 49 items
- United States
379
Purchases
Buyer Rating:
3.88 stars
3.88 average based on 42 ratings.
-
5 Star
2661%
-
4 Star
49%
-
3 Star
24%
-
2 Star
12%
-
1 Star
921%
| Created | 14 May 12 |
| Last Update | 24 August 12 |
| Compatible Browsers | IE8, IE9, Firefox, Safari, Opera, Chrome |
| Software Version | PHP 5.3, MySQL 5.x, jQuery |
| Files Included | JavaScript JS, JavaScript JSON, CSS, PHP |
- bing
- checker
- php
- rank checker
- rank tracker
- ranking
- search engine optimization
- search ranking
- seo
- serp
© All Rights Reserved jdgower -
Contact Envato Support


Gr8, that’s all i wanted to know, also sometimes coders do all sorts of encoding out of paranoia!
Also can you recommend some proxys that are good and well priced?
In the past I’ve used myprivateproxy.net
Hello,
I have bought the script, but I see an empty screen in the list of keywords. I have added the domain and keywords. I have set the cronjob every hour and I’ve run manually.
I see the data in the tables, but I see nothing in my interface :’(
thanks!! Emiliano
I am e-mailing this and replying to your comment for other’s benefit because your issues encompass pretty much all of the problems people have with the script. 4 things could be causing your problem:
You have PHP 5.2.17 installed and PHP 5.3+ is required.
When you entered the domain you put http:// – remove that…you should only put the subdomain, so if you use www. include that (if not, then don’t), but do not include the http:// under any circumstances.
You have a duplicate keyword in the keywords table. Remove either id 46 or 47.
You have 290 keywords in the database and are not using proxies. There is no way that will work. I would recommend getting 8 proxies to be able to support that many keywords (approximately 1 proxy per 40 keywords, minimum 2).
Hi -cit:” (set up for United States)” – is possible to setup other country?
Yes. This is most easily done for Google…just search/replace the google.com in addkeywords, refreshkeyword and scrape PHP files with your Google of choice…Bing’s is a little more complicated but it’s do-able.
Can you tell me how to set it to find more than top 50 results?
change $howmanyresults variable in scrape.php, refreshkeyword.php and addkeywords.php. I don’t recommend this for multiple reasons, but mostly because 50+ results have A LOT of variance, they dont really matter other than letting clients know just how horrible their SEO currently is and that’s going to be a lot of scraping, the more results you scrape the more proxies you’ll need.
Also, program seems to act flakey. I added a new site, with only 3 keywords. No http://. No results showing. ranking table empty. scrape errors empty
I only got it to work one time when first isntalled, using one keyword. after I saw the one keyword worked, I added like 30 keywords to that campaign, and it never showed up in results. waited like 10 minutes to see any more, just the first one entered showed.
deleted campaign, made new one with 30 keywods from beginning, none showed.
deleted that, made new campign with new domain, and just 3 kws, nothign showing.
Also date says for Jan 01, 1970 under Exceptional Rankings
Also getting: Notice: Undefined index: in C:\xampp\htdocs\ranktracker\scrape.php on line 35 when I ran scrape.php from browser.
Also Notice: Undefined offset: 2 in C:\xampp\htdocs\ranktracker\scrape.php on line 240
Notice: Trying to get property of non-object in C:\xampp\htdocs\ranktracker\scrape.php on line 241
Holy spam, batman. People, please use the contact form so that it goes directly to me
Anyway, e-mailing you through PM.
I apologize, thought the comments here would help others. But yes PM is fine. Thanks for your quick response. Sorry!
Hello jdgower, One of my client has purchased SERP Tracking application from you. He is getting some warning messages and couldn’t run the application properly. He asked me to fix the issue. I am looking into the application folder named “files”. I am unable to understand the flow of application. He suggested me to follow scrape.php file but I didn’t find any file that is using scrape.php. Is scrape.php file is independent? Please provide me the info so that I can fix the issue. Thanks, Binoy kumar.
If you/he sends me the URL I’d be happy to take a look at it. Anyhow, scrape.php is simply run by the cron job that has to be setup and it is independent from every other script. In actuality, addkeywords, scrape and refreshkeyword are all very similar.
Here I have added few website and some keywords in each website. In the database I can see daily_results table is being filled up with data. It is near about 500 records. Rankings and scrape_errors table are filled up with only one record.
When I click on the website using “Select a campaign” option in the top then I can see the graph with empty, stating that “No data available in table”. Can you tell me why I am not getting data here?
I have uploaded the application in my own server, also set up the database there. Do I need to do something else apart from uploading the files in server and setting up the database?
Thanks.
Not sure if you’ve taken it down since you replied, but I cannot access it.
Hello jdgower, I am not getting you. R you not able to access the link that I provided you?
If you have no issue, Can I share my skype id or gtalk id so that we can communicate properly?
PM me through my profile to communicate via email. And yes, click the link above that you gave…at least for me it doesn’t work. I did a little research and saw the gig you got. In the description he says that he is running PHP 5.2.17. It absolutely will not work correctly on anything less than 5.3.
when you are clicking the link. May I know what you are getting means what error messages? Can you see the login screen?
ok. let me provide you some other link. www.xplorindia.in/st/ please go here and let me know if you can make access this link. Thanks.
ok. let me provide you some other link. http://www.xplorindia.in/st/ please go here and let me know if you can make access this link. Thanks.
I can get to the script now, but the PHP version is 5.2.17. After you’ve upgraded send me a PM and I will further assist.
Hi there. I would like to track rankings of around 1,000 keywords for my site. Any thoughts around how many different proxies I would need in order to have nightly rank updates run successfully?
Also, is there anything that blocks me from adding a duplicate keyword? Let’s say I a add a keyword on day 1, but then try to add the same keyword again on day 10. Is there anything in place that will tell me that the keyword is already being tracked?
Thanks!
First question – that’s gonna be tough. I’d normally recommend at least 1 proxy for every 40 keywords (minimum 2)...and that’s with 50 results…do the math and that’s 1 proxy for every 2 keywords.
Second question – strange question. I really should fix that, right? Anyway, no, and further – it will let you add the keyword and it will actually break the script.
May I ask does this support reporting. I like the look of the script but I would want to export the results of a campaign to a PDF? Does this allow this?
It does not. I’m sure you could build it as it’s all put into a mysql database, but it doesn’t support it out of the box. Sorry.
Hi,
I sent you a PM. Please check and respond.
Thanks
Is there any update ? This script doesn’t work long time and I don’t see any update.
The script works. Please PM me your info and I’ll take a look for you to see what’s going on. Also, the warning you mention is because there are no competitors on one or all of your campaigns. It will not stop the script from working.
I have this error: Warning: Invalid argument supplied for foreach() in scrape.php on line 276
1. installed the script 2. setup one website and 10 keywords 3. I get a list of all my competitors in the cron email but nothing populates in the portal empty – does not work for me
Please PM me from my profile with a URL and I will find out and tell you what is wrong.
I installed the script and created an campaign but the screen is blank.
Please PM me from my profile with a URL and I will find out and tell you what is wrong.
JD – what’s up! any updates in the future?
Are you having any issues?
No we are all good here, just checking in
Purchased this tool but got the following error while executing the scrape.php script. Fatal error: Call to a member function getElementById() on a non-object in /......./scrape.php on line 144